Output 905e73a6ff9253ac76c6e2867993f01b535222d157d8f4d3595e92fde6fdc067:0

value
16642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5d2376a930314392d04bc35aed4c32d520dd2e OP_EQUAL
address
32pPcDxRuaPPUSHqQfB9FtamEdferF8FQD
transaction
905e73a6ff9253ac76c6e2867993f01b535222d157d8f4d3595e92fde6fdc067
spent
true